    Absolutely. Scripture is clear in commanding us to teach our children to know God’s word. The psalmist says he has hidden God’s word in his heart that he might not sin against God. We are instructed to train children in the way that they should go — and promised that they will not depart from it when they are old. Christ sets the example of studying scripture in His childhood and then using it to avoid temptation in adulthood. Scripture contains the answers to the “big questions” of life. More and more, those who call themselves Christians are being seduced by the philosophies of the world. If Scripture is not in our students’ hearts and minds, there will be little hope for teaching them to discern the lies that are so cleverly packaged today.

    I can say first hand that it is vital for young children to know scripture. I cannot tell you how a scripture I learned as a child has stuck with me. Being able to recall scripture when going through difficult times or trying to discern God’s will has been comforting for me. The Bible tells us to train up a child in the way they should go and when they are older, they will not depart from it. God gives us all free will. There will be times in life when our students will test what they have learned against the principles of the world. They may even stray from their Christian upbringing even if for a short time. That happened in my own life. The one thing that remained constant, even when I strayed as a young adult, it that scripture was always brought back to mind and that kept Jesus’ hand on my heart and life. He left His flock many a time to retrieve me and welcome me back into the fold. If students are rooted in the practice of memorizing scripture, being shown how scripture truly is relevant to their daily lives and learn how to navigate their Bible, they too will be able to recall and depend on scripture as their root in Christianity, their lifeline to God.
